The median expected salary for a typical Database Librarian
in the United States is $53,556. This basic
market pricing report was prepared using our Certified Compensation Professionals'
analysis of survey data collected from thousands of HR departments at employers
of all sizes, industries and geographies.
|
|
Source: HR Reported data as of May 2013

Job Description for Database Librarian

Designs, enters, audits and maintains data database. Responsible for verifying all data to be entered into database meets set standards and requirements. May require an associate's degree in a related area and 3-5 years of experience in the field or in a related area. Familiar with a variety of the field's concepts, practices, and procedures. Relies on experience and judgment to plan and accomplish goals. Performs a variety of complicated tasks. May lead and direct the work of others. Typically reports to a manager. A wide degree of creativity and latitude is expected.
